The Arizona Diamondbacks enter the three-game home series against the Los Angeles Angels with a stronger overall record near .500 in the NL West, while the Angels sit at 29-42 in the AL West. Chase Field home advantage and recent team momentum favor the Diamondbacks, who have shown solid offensive output despite key absences. Lourdes Gurriel Jr. remains on the 10-day IL with a hamstring issue, and several bullpen arms occupy longer-term lists. The Angels, fresh off an 8-0 shutout of the Rays, continue to battle multiple injuries including Adam Frazier on the 10-day IL and Yusei Kikuchi on the 60-day list with shoulder inflammation, limiting rotation depth. Both clubs face tight playoff math in their respective leagues, making series results pivotal for late-June positioning amid ongoing roster management and pitching matchups.
